Benzo Scarlet B C by The Bayer Company Limited, Manchester, Bradford, Glasgow, London, Belfast in Great Britain & Northern Ireland. One of a collection of colour dyes in bottles from the Colour Museum in Bradford, West Yorkshire, c.1900.
